How to request a flexible work schedule CC039

Anna Meller is the Work ReBalance Mentor and works with ambitious professional women who want to balance their corporate career with their family life. Through her Balanced Leader group programmes and bespoke coaching/mentoring, Anna empowers women to make choices that work for them and their employers.

Over the summer the EHRC was the latest body to add its voice to mounting calls for greater access to flexible working as a way of reducing pay gaps and helping women progress.

Legislation already exists allowing any qualifying employee to ask for flexible working and most organisations have relevant policies. However, negotiating a flexible schedule can still be challenging – particularly as you progress up the career ladder.

To celebrate #NationalWorkLifeWeek, from 2-6 October 2017,  and in the US #WorkAndFamilyMonth throughout October, Anna and I explore seven steps to confidently negotiate a flexible working arrangement that both suits you and your employer.

  1. Be very clear on what you want.
  2. Be clear on your value to your employer.
  3. The reasons your request might be refused.
  4. Review what your existing HR policies allow.
  5. Identify what’s under the radar.
  6. Prepare your case.
  7. Be willing to agree to a trial period.
